Q3 Planning Note — Branch Managers

Quick update on the Marlowe & Tern term sheet. Their offer covers co-branded lending desks across our Westvale and Corrin branches, with a revenue split that's friendlier than expected. Legal is still chewing on the exclusivity clause, so don't promise anything to local partners yet. We'll circulate final terms once Priya signs off. For context on where this fits in our roadmap, see the note below.

management briefing: Jorixax Holdings is in early talks to buy Casixax Holdings for about $420.3 million. The Fenmir launch date is October 27, and nothing goes to the press before then. Legal wants the Keloxek Foods term sheet redrafted before April 16.

**Ticket: Signature check failing on Vaultwren plugin install**

Several external plugins fail verification against the Vaultwren secrets-rotation utility since release 3.2. Root cause: the old signing key was retired last week. Plugin authors must re-verify their bundles against the updated key. No code changes needed. Update your trust configuration with the key below.

signing key of yahag-hahap = bky19_fv6WaqDUcbASx8HTGob

**Finance Review Summary — Insurance Renewal, Tarwell Marine**

Quick one for the finance team: the annual renewal with Ostgard Mutual landed 9% higher, mostly down to last year's hull claim on the Perrin Bay run. We pushed back and got the deductible trimmed, so net impact is closer to 6%. Cover terms otherwise unchanged. Budget line updated accordingly. Forward-looking detail sits below.

internal memo for kawip-hadug: Headcount on the Wenwyn team goes from 7 to 140 by the end of January. Gross margin on Wenwyn came in at 20 percent against a plan of 15 percent.

## Account Recovery — Squintcheck Scanner

For the weekly eng sync: if the service account that runs the Squintcheck typo-squatting scanner is locked out, do not re-provision it from scratch — that invalidates three months of registry trust scores. Instead, verify the lockout in the audit feed, confirm no pending scan jobs are mid-publish, and page a second approver from the registry-integrity rotation. With both approvers present, open the sealed recovery envelope and restore access using the passphrase written just below.

recovery phrase for yahag-yagap: pramir-normir-norius-kasax